Amendment to the Public Spaces Protection Order (PSPO), Dog Control & Fouling Enforcement Powers

14/04/2020 - Amendment to the Public Spaces Protection Order (PSPO), Dog Control & Fouling Enforcement Powers

(1) Amendment of the current Public Spaces Protection Order (PSPO) under Section 59 of the Anti-Social Behaviour, Crime and Policing Act 2014, so that a person can be in charge of no more than four dogs at any one time in a public place unless they have a licence, be approved. 

 

(2) The introduction of a professional dog walking licence for persons wishing to walk more than four dogs and up to a maximum of six dogs at a cost of £200 per annum be approved.

 

(3) An increase in the current Fixed Penalty Notice of £80 to £100 for all offences (controls) contained in the PSPO.
